Synopsis
Metadata properties used and returned by DSC for configuration and resource operations.

Properties
duration
Defines the duration of a DSC operation against a configuration document or resource instance as a
string following the format defined in ISO8601 ABNF for duration
.
For example, PT0.611216S
represents a duration of about 0.61
seconds.
SchemaDialect: https://json-schema.org/draft/2020-12/schema
SchemaID: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/PowerShell/DSC/main/schemas/v3.1.0/metadata/Microsoft.DSC/duration.json
Type: string
Format: duration
endDateTime
Defines the end date and time for the DSC operation as a timestamp following the format defined in
RFC3339, section 5.6 (see date-time
).
For example: 2024-04-14T08:49:51.395686600-07:00
SchemaDialect: https://json-schema.org/draft/2020-12/schema
SchemaID: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/PowerShell/DSC/main/schemas/v3.1.0/metadata/Microsoft.DSC/endDateTime.json
Type: string
Format: date-time
executionType
Defines whether DSC actually applied an operation to the configuration or was run in WhatIf
mode.
This property is always Actual
for Get
, Test
, and Export
operations. For Set
operations,
this value is WhatIf
when DSC is invoked with the --whatIf
argument.
SchemaDialect: https://json-schema.org/draft/2020-12/schema
SchemaID: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/PowerShell/DSC/main/schemas/v3.1.0/metadata/Microsoft.DSC/executionType.json
Type: string
ValidValues: [Actual, WhatIf]
operation
Defines the operation that DSC applied to the configuration document: Get
, Set
, Test
, or
Export
.
SchemaDialect: https://json-schema.org/draft/2020-12/schema
SchemaID: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/PowerShell/DSC/main/schemas/v3.1.0/metadata/Microsoft.DSC/operation.json
Type: string
ValidValues: [Get, Set, Test, Export]
securityContext
Defines the security context that DSC was run under. If the value for this metadata property is
Elevated
, DSC was run as root
(non-Windows) or an elevated session with Administrator
privileges (on Windows). If the value is Restricted
, DSC was run as a normal user or account in a
non-elevated session.
SchemaDialect: https://json-schema.org/draft/2020-12/schema
SchemaID: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/PowerShell/DSC/main/schemas/v3.1.0/metadata/Microsoft.DSC/securityContext.json
Type: string
ValidValues: [Current, Elevated, Restricted]
startDatetime
Defines the start date and time for the DSC operation as a timestamp following the format defined
in RFC3339, section 5.6 (see date-time
).
For example: 2024-04-14T08:49:51.395686600-07:00
SchemaDialect: https://json-schema.org/draft/2020-12/schema
SchemaID: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/PowerShell/DSC/main/schemas/v3.1.0/metadata/Microsoft.DSC/startDatetime.json
Type: string
Format: date-time
version
Defines the version of DSC that ran the command. This value is always the semantic version of the
DSC command, like 3.0.0-preview.7
.
SchemaDialect: https://json-schema.org/draft/2020-12/schema
SchemaID: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/PowerShell/DSC/main/schemas/v3.1.0/metadata/Microsoft.DSC/version.json
Type: object
